I'm always amazed by the fact that PCs die, freeze, get viruses, and generally suck over time. My TI is 30 years old and turns on and runs every time, no issues, no problems...

 

Ignoring the issues of complexity, not to mention cheap parts and the like... if your PC reverted to factory settings every time you powered it off, it wouldn't have 90% of the problems it has. This was a strong benefit of ROM-based machines. A bit of a weakness, too, since you couldn't easily upgrade them, but neither could malicious software. ;)
